In recent decades, authors affiliated with Institut National d'Optique have published 686 papers, which have received a total of 9.5k indexed citations. Scholars at this organization have produced 305 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 203 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 122 papers in Biomedical Engineering on the topics of Advanced Fiber Laser Technologies (97 papers), Photonic and Optical Devices (82 papers) and Advanced Fiber Optic Sensors (68 papers). Their work is cited by papers focused on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(3.8k cit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(3.6k citations) and Biomedical Engineering (1.3k citations). Authors at Institut National d'Optique collaborate with scholars in Canada, United States and France and have published in prestigious journals including Nature, Physical Review Letters and Nano Letters. Some of Institut National d'Optique's most productive authors include Hubert Jerominek, C. Paré, See Leang Chin, S. L. Chin, Weiwei Liu, Réal Vallée, F. Théberge, Andreas Becker, P. A. Bélanger and Mirosław Florjańczyk.
